Porini Lion Camp is located in the exclusive 20,000 acre Olare Orok Conservancy. This expansive conservancy, which borders the Masai Mara Game Reserve is home to an abundance of animals including the Big Cats for which the Mara is famous. Lion Porini Camp location [click here]

The Camp is situated along the banks of the Ntiakatiak River, a seasonal river with some permanent hippo pools near the camp. With 10 luxury guest tents the camp is very exclusive, giving you a real ‘in the bush’ experience. The tents are very spacious and have private verandahs along the length of the tent, providing a secluded and private 'space' for you to relax and enjoy the beauty of this African wilderness. Each tent has en-suite bathrooms with flush toilets and hot showers. Food is excellent with fresh baked bread and high quality meals prepared by the camp Chef.

At camp guests enjoy morning, evening and night game drives in custom built 4x4's. Sundowners at scenic viewing points, from where you can enjoy a drink watching the sun set over the Mara. And escorted bush walks with Maasai warriors and safari guide, where you can get an insight into the Maasai people, their way of life and also learn more about the animals, birds and plants of the Mara.

Facilities and activities included for all guests:

Large Safari tents with a double and single bed, solar electric lights, en suite bathrooms with flush toilet and safari shower.

All meals and picnic lunches, free mineral water, sodas, gin, beer and house wine.

Custom built 4x4 safari vehicles for game drives.

Expert driver-guides. Morning, evening and night game drives in Olare Orok Conservancy.

Full day in Mara National Reserve with picnic lunch.

Escorted walk with Maasai guides.

Sundowner drinks to watch the sunset from scenic viewing points.

Transfers from airstrip to Porini Lion Camp.

PORINI LION CAMP Itinerary- Duration: 2 nights / 3 days

Day 1

Depart Nairobi Wilson Airportat 10 am for your 50 minute flight into the heart of the Masai Mara National Reserve. You'll be met at the airstrip by your safari guide from Porini Lion Camp in open-sided 4x4 safari vehicle to transfer to Porini Lion Camp in the adjacent Olare Orok Conservancy, arriving in time for lunch. In the afternoon you will go on a game drive in Olare Orok Conservancy, stopping for a sundowner at a scenic viewpoint, followed by a night game drive to look for nocturnal animals. Return to camp for dinner and overnight.

Day 2

*Optional Balloon Safari and ChampagneBreakfast. [ click here]
Awake at dawn to the natural sounds of Masai Mara's birdlife. After an early breakfast you will have a full day "on safari" in the Mara Reserve with a picnic lunch, on the look out for the Big Cats. Return to Porini Lion Camp in the late afternoon for a shower, dinner and overnight.

Day 3

Early morning walk with Maasai warriors or game drive in the Conservancy, followed by breakfast. Then depart on the flight back to Nairobi, arriving around 12.15 pm.
